Visual Fan completes 1 MWp solar plant for Saint-Gobain

Green Forum
Romanian tech firm Visual Fan, operating under the Allview brand, announced the completion of a 1 MWp photovoltaic (PV) plant for Saint-Gobain's Romanian division. 

The system was installed on the roof of Saint-Gobain's plasterboard factory in Turda, Cluj county. Co-financed through the National Resilience and Recovery Plan (NRRP), the plant was developed over eight weeks and features 1,725 solar panels covering nearly 7,000 sq m. 

"We aim for zero net carbon emissions by 2050," said Ovidiu Pascutiu, CEO of Saint-Gobain Romania.
